From publisher blurb: Adventure in a Con: an adventure designed with the Æther Random Setting Generator, run Friday night of a convention, written on Saturday of the convention, and illustrated by an artist who attended the convention. It’s an entire adventure pulling talent from a convetion! It’s an Adventure in a Con! The Eater’s Tower A powerful cursed Human, an Eater, has taken up residence in an abandoned Byzantine tower which was long-ago overgrown by the forest it used to protect. The party finds their way to the tower, possibly hunting the Eater, possibly seeking shelter from the dark of the woods; but no matter what their purpose is, they have a fight on their hands! This adventure was designed by using the Random Setting Generator included in the Æther Core Book and was designed at Vermincon in Vermillion, South Dakota on January 25th of 2013. The players rolled the various aspects of three settings and chose their favorite from those results. This adventure was based entirely on their rolls: a Byzantine Empire setting with Renaissance Age level of technology that was a supernatural, alternate history setting. This resulting adventure was crafted through their actions, written during the convention by Kevin Rohan and illustrated by the guest of honor, artist Fredd Gorham. It is designed for three to six players, and, true to its roots, is perfect for either a convention game, a one-shot game, or possibly even a springboard into a larger campaign!
